Beat together the brown sugar, shortening, JIF peanut butter, milk, and vanilla in a large bowl with an electric mixer. Using medium speed, beat the ingredients until well blended. Add in the egg and beat until it is just incorporated. Whisk the flour with baking soda and salt in a separate bowl before adding to the sugar mixture.
Combine peanut butter, shortening, brown sugar, milk and vanilla in large bowl. Beat at medium speed of electric mixer until well blended. Add egg. Beat just until blended. Add the salt and baking soda and stir until mixed, then pour in the flour and mix on low until fully blended.

If you want your Jif cookies to have some crunch, you will need to use more crunchy peanut butter since the peanuts will take up space in your measuring cup, and you’ll need to account for that. There is no need to chill this dough before you scoop and bake since the shortening will hold up well in the oven.
